Vegan Yakisoba
It’s a typical Japanese dish, very healthy and complete, which I “veganized”.
Ingredients:
1 red pepper, green or yellow (as you prefer it)
1 onion
250 gr soya steaks, soaked overnight
1 medium cauliflower
150 gr noodles
2 carrots
1 tablespoon olive oil
2 tablespoons shoyo
1 tablespoon cornstarch (cornflour)
Method:
Blunt and scrape the carrots, wash and cut them into small pieces, as well as the pepper. Cut out the florets of broccoli.
In a steamer, steam cook broccoli, carrots and pepper.
Cut the soy steaks into small pieces and steam cook them, but not together woth the vegetables. Cook the noodles leaving them “al dente”.
In a wok (or in a normal pot if you don’t have it) fry the the onion in a bit of oil; sauté the vegetables first, then the soy steaks and finally the noodles. Dissolve starch and shoyo in 60ml of water. Add them in the wok where the vegetables are and leave them a few minutes, until it becomes creamy. Turn the heat off and eat.
